As one of the world’s top three credit ratings agencies, Fitch Ratings plays a critical role in global capital markets by providing supplementary credit analysis, ratings, research, and commentary to financial market participants. For over 100 years, Fitch Ratings has been creating value for global markets through its rigorous analysis and deep expertise, which have resulted in a variety of market‑leading tools, methodologies, indices, research, and analytical products.
Fitch Ratings is part of Fitch Group, a global leader in financial information services with operations in more than 30 countries, which also includes Fitch Solutions. With dual headquarters in London and New York, Fitch Group is owned by Hearst.

Senior Analyst – Residential Mortgage‑Backed Securities Group (RMBS) in our Chicago office About the Team:The U.S. Residential Mortgage‑Backed Securities (RMBS) group is adding a Credit Analyst or a Senior Credit Analyst to its growing team. This position will collaborate with more senior analysts on transaction analysis; run computer models and perform spreadsheet analysis to evaluate credit risk and cash‑flow coverage for RMBS transactions; present transaction reviews and analysis at rating committees; develop an understanding of legal and accounting issues affecting a security;
and contribute to research reports and press releases.
- Analyze critical credit, legal and structural elements of residential mortgage‑backed transactions
- Assist in the development of rating criteria, including writing relevant reports and developing recommendations to bolster analysis
- Produce quality internal and external written reports including credit committees, criteria, special reports and market commentary
- Communicate Fitch rating methodology and criteria to issuers and investors
- Deployment and implementation of cash‑flow models and tools used in the rating process
- Lead and/or support research projects
- Maintain assigned rating relationship
